Saudi Students Fatima Buali and Retaj Al-Saleh Win Bronze and Honorable Mention at 2024 European Girls' Mathematical Olympiad
Two exceptional Saudi students, Fatima Buali from Al-Ahsa City and Retaj Al-Saleh from the Eastern Region, showcased their impressive mathematical skills and dedication at the 2024 European Girls' Mathematical Olympiad (EGMO) held in Georgia.
Fatima Buali earned a bronze medal in this prestigious competition, while Retaj Al-Saleh received an honorable mention for her outstanding performance.
Their achievements were the result of rigorous selection and intensive training provided by the King Abdulaziz and His Companions Foundation for Giftedness and Creativity (Mawhiba) in collaboration with the Ministry of Education.
The EGMO attracted 212 talented students from 54 countries, underscoring the global significance of the event.
Saudi Arabia's consistent participation in the EGMO has yielded significant results, with a total of two gold medals, six silver medals, thirteen bronze medals, and seven honorable mentions over the past 12 years.
